引言

近期,国内主流原型设计工具墨刀推出了“变量、条件判断、函数”等功能,立刻在交互设计师与资深产品经理群体中引起热议。作为国产轻量级原型设计工具的龙头代表,墨刀早已俘获了中小团队和初级产品经理用户的青睐,而在高级交互领域,老牌海外工具Axure凭借其成熟的高级交互功能独占高阶原型设计的山头。

如今墨刀的这次高级交互功能上线,意味着它朝着实现复杂业务场景的原型设计迈出了关键的一步,本文将从功能演进、操作对比与未来竞争力三方面,深入剖析墨刀新上线的高级交互能力,并探讨它与Axure差异和未来发展前景。

一、墨刀与Axure交互功能演进

1. 墨刀

早在推出高级交互功能之前,墨刀便凭借其简洁的界面布局和拖拽式操作,给习惯了繁琐操作的Axure用户带来眼前一亮的体验,尤其墨刀素材广场资源丰富,满足大多数快速迭代与高保真原型需求,成为了更多产品经理的选择。虽然它的功能全面性已经满足大部分产品经理的日常工作需求,但是对于有高级交互复杂项目原型设计需求的PM来说,还不能够完全适用。

  1. Axure

    Axure诞生之初即瞄准了企业级复杂交互需求,其功能深度填补了早期市场的空白,甚至吸引了本非核心用户的产品经理群体。它的高级交互功能可以让设计师与产品经理模拟复杂流程,但陡峭的学习曲线和繁琐的交互面板,让新手产品经理望而却步,随着墨刀等轻量化工具的普及,Axure用户群体逐渐收窄,仅剩需处理复杂逻辑的设计师仍依赖其功能深度。

此次,墨刀对“变量、条件判断、函数”功能的支持,可以视作国产工具在高级交互领域的“破冰”之举。对于高级交互功能的需求,墨刀十分重视,一直在交互功能上与Axure看齐。

二、墨刀vsAxure高级交互对比

墨刀上线的变量与条件判断,以及函数功能,在原理上是与Axure无异,能够实现多种动态交互效果,但是同样的功能设置操作方式上,两者略有不同。

1.墨刀高级交互功能更简单

与Axure的繁琐配置相比,墨刀的交互功能操作十分简单。举例一个常见签到金币变量的例子,使用墨刀进行变量设置与交互条件的操作,只需要简单3步,即可0代码实现交互效果:

2.Axure高级交互功能更丰富

虽然墨刀目前上线的高级交互功能,已经可以替代Axure的同类型功能,但是例如Axure中继器等还是独有的特色功能,相比之下要更加丰富一些。但是墨刀在高级交互功能的路线上已经踏出了关键一步,相信不久的未来真的可以完全达到Axure的交互事件水平。

三、预测墨刀Axure未来竞争力

1. 原型设计趋势:

原型设计工具的选择,往往取决于团队的项目需求与交付节奏。在细分行业或企业中,原型完成度有不同的需求,例如软件外包公司作为乙方,需要向甲方需求者演示汇报,常以高保真交互原型作为产品经理的工作要求;而SaaS企业内的产品经理由于迭代速度较快,常以低保真静态原型来快速表达想法......

总之,原型设计在未来仍然是产品经理工作中必不可少的环节,不论在工作中需要绘制哪种类型的原型图,产品经理对于工具的选择都有着相同的目标:满足需求与快速绘制。

2. 未来竞争力:

Axure一直以来因学习曲线高、操作繁琐复杂,无法满足快速绘制的需求,即便近年来不断更新版本,但是庞杂的系统还是无法简易化;而墨刀虽然能够借助素材广场、组件库以及操作易用性,达到快速原型制作的效果,但是其交互功能不能满足复杂业务产品经理的需求。正是如此,当墨刀开始满足这部分PM的需求时,Axure的危机将再次涌现。

当高级交互场景频次增长,墨刀已不再是仅能画静态线框的“轻量级”工具,而正在覆盖更多复杂业务场景。结合其云端协作、组件素材的优势,或将在下一个阶段迎来行业升级。

结语

在未来发展中,或许墨刀会持续完善高级交互模块,甚至导入更多可视化函数、数据联动与第三方API 调用能力。Axure也会在易用性与性能上不断打磨。对于产品经理来说,重要的仍是衡量团队交付节奏与项目复杂度,选择最适合的工具。原型设计工具的两大巨头品牌的未来发展,你更看好谁?

墨刀上线高级交互功能,能否超越Axure?的更多相关文章

  1. pop,墨刀,快现、justinmind 、Axure

    原型设计软件 墨刀:https://modao.cc Justinmind: http://www.zhihu.com/question/26662368/answer/33586218 http:/ ...

  2. Axure10种非交互功能简介(引自人人都是产品经理)

    一.notes:控件和页面注释 越来越多的PM开始用Axure来写PRD,但行内并不存在约定成俗的文档规范.作者目前为止见过的Axure版PRD中,大部分采用原型+旁边文字标注的方法来表达产品逻辑.其 ...

  3. 6种原型设计工具大比对! Axure,Invision, 墨刀……哪款适合你?

    每一年的毕业季都是找工作高峰时期,产品经理.UI设计师这些岗位都会接触到原型设计工具.选择原型设计工具最重要的一点:适合自己的才是最好的! 下文将对目前超火的原型工具进行大对比,快来看看那一款于你而言 ...

  4. 墨刀联合有赞Vant组件库,让你轻松设计出电商原型

    继上周新上线了简历模板之后,本周墨刀的原型模板库又欢喜地增添一名新成员! 有赞Vant组件库 (做电商的宝宝要捂嘴笑了)   Vant 组件库是有赞前端团队开源的一套基于Vue的UI组件库,目前版本收 ...

  5. 网站app原型设计工具:axure,Mockups,墨刀

    网站app原型设计工具:axure,Mockups,墨刀 Balsamiq Mockups 3 网站原型设计工具非常高效,非常简单,几分钟就能搞定比axure好用很多 墨刀 - 免费的移动应用原型与线 ...

  6. 原型工具介绍———墨刀以及Axure RP比较

    原型工具——墨刀以及Axure的比较 1759233 目录 一.了解背景... 1 二.下面分开介绍一下这两款工具... 1 2.1 Axure RP. 1 2.2墨刀... 6 三.比较... 8 ...

  7. Mockplus、Axure、墨刀软件对比

    Mockplus 优点:基础版免费使用,操作简单,上手快,交互简单(只需拖曳就可以),功能多样,组件资源丰富,预览方式和导出类型多样,支持团队协作. 缺点:不支持手势交互. Axure 优点:操作变化 ...

  8. 跨平台技术实践案例: 用 reactxp 重写墨刀的移动端

    Authors:  Gao Cong, Perry Poon Illustrators:  Shena Bian April 20, 2019 重新编写,又一次,我们又一次重新编写了移动端应用和移动端 ...

  9. iOS开发之功能模块--高仿Boss直聘的IM界面交互功能

    本人公司项目属于社交类,高仿Boss直聘早期的版本,现在Boss直聘界面风格,交互风格都不如Boss直聘以前版本的好看. 本人通过iPhone模拟器和本人真机对聊,将完成的交互功能通过Mac截屏模拟器 ...

  10. 墨刀 手机app原型工具

    https://modao.io 并且墨刀对开放项目永久免费!

随机推荐

  1. Flink mysql-cdc同步主键分布不均匀的mysql表

    一.背景 1.遇到问题描述 通过Flink同步mysql到iceberg中,任务一直在运行中,但是在目标表看不到数据.经排查发现job manager一直在做切片工作,切了一小时还没开始同步数据,日志 ...

  2. FreeSql学习笔记——3.查询

    前言   FreeSql中查询的支持非常丰富,包括链式语法,多表查询,表达式函数:写法多种多样,可以使用简单的条件查询.sql查询.联表.子表等方式用于查询数据, 查询的格式也有很丰富,包括单条记录, ...

  3. JUC并发—5.AQS源码分析一

    大纲 1.JUC中的Lock接口 2.如何实现具有阻塞或唤醒功能的锁 3.AQS抽象队列同步器的理解 4.基于AQS实现的ReentractLock 5.ReentractLock如何获取锁 6.AQ ...

  4. Java开发中long类型转换json传递到前端后精度丢失问题

    将文章的id由long类型手动改为String类型(需要修改表结构); 可以使用Jackson进行序列化解决

  5. Docker安装mongoDB及使用教程

    一.mongoDB是什么? MongoDB是一个NoSQL的非关系型数据库 ,支持海量数据存储,高性能的读写. mongoDB的特点(或使用场景) 1.支持存储海量数据:(例如:直播中的打赏数据): ...

  6. springboot+vue项目:工具箱

    常用账号管理:工作相关账号.游戏账号.各平台账号 加班调休管理:公司没有对应的系统,需要自己记录加班调休情况. 待办事项:方便记录待办,以提醒还有哪些事情没有办理. 待实现功能: 1.点击侧边栏菜单, ...

  7. FastAPI路由与请求处理进阶指南:解锁企业级API开发黑科技 🔥

    title: FastAPI路由与请求处理进阶指南:解锁企业级API开发黑科技 date: 2025/3/3 updated: 2025/3/3 author: cmdragon excerpt: 5 ...

  8. PHP中类和对象相关的函数

    1.class_exists 用于判断一个类是否存在,参数为类名: 2.interface_exists 判断一个接口是否存在,参数为接口名: 3.method_exists 判断一个方法是否存在,参 ...

  9. 是否有必要使用 Oracle 向量数据库?

    向量数据库最主要的特点是让传统的只能基于具体值/关键字的数据检索,进化到了可以直接基于语义的数据检索.这在AI时代至关重要! 回到标题问题:是否有必要使用 Oracle 向量数据库? 这实际还要取决于 ...

  10. 删除空白行,报错 raise KeyError(list(np.compress(check, subset))) KeyError: ['姓名']

    之前这段程序跑完后没报错,经调试发现到这一句报错 > df.dropna(subset=['姓名'],inplace=True) 意思是删除'姓名'列 含有'NAN'的行 思考第一步:应该是 d ...